PROC 232 - Principles of Quality PREREQUISITES: PROC 131 - Introduction to Process Technology . PROGRAM: Industrial Technology CREDIT HOURS MIN: 3 LECTURE HOURS MIN: 3 DATE OF LAST REVISION: Summer, 2014
Provides an introduction to the field of quality within the process industry. Students will be introduced to many process industry-related quality concepts including operating consistency, continuous improvement, plant economics, team skills, and statistical process control (SPC).
MAJOR COURSE LEARNING OBJECTIVES: Upon successful completion of this course the student will be expected to:
- Discuss the history of the quality movement in the United States and the state of the movement in the process industry. [a,e,i]
- Describe the impact of quality on the organization’s economic performance. [a,e,i]
- Meet or exceed customer expectations. [a,e,h]
- Define personal effectiveness techniques. [a,e]
- Use effective system communication techniques to ensure operating consistency and reduce variability in the process. [a,f]
- Function as an effective team member. [a,d]
- Discuss the principles associated with process orientation and system thinking and theory. [a,e]
- Contribute to the establishment and success of a learning organization. [a,h]
- Demonstrate how to follow procedures and policies in order to ensure operating consistency, reduce variability in the process, reduce waste, and prevent safety incidents. [a,b,c]
- Use continuous improvement methodology to optimize processes. [a,i]
- Describe preventive or corrective action to ensure operating consistency, reduce variability in the process, reduce waste, and prevent process safety incidents. [a,b]
- Use problem solving and decision making techniques to identify areas for improvement and correct process deficiencies. [a,e]
- Use quality tools and team problem solving to resolve a real-world, process industry dilemma. [a,d,i]
- Use basic statistics in one’s work. [a,i]
- Collect valid and reliable data to use in the analysis of process problems or to plan for process improvement. [a,i]
- Represent, analyze, and interpret process data using various types of control charts and quality tools.[a.e,i]
- Use process capability data in one’s work as necessary. [a,i]
- Apply data collection, representation, analysis, and interpretation skills in a real-world, process industry scenario. [a,b,e]
